François-Henri Pinault: King of Luxury

News & Trends: François-Henri Pinault is a name to know. The billionaire heir has been at the helm of many of his family's holdings since 2005.

The publicly traded, $28-billion-a-year conglomerate that makes up much of the family's fortune, is called PPR and owns some of the world's best-known luxury brands, including Gucci, Bottega Veneta, and Yves Saint Laurent, not to mention smaller haute designers like Stella McCartney and the late Alexander McQueen.

His father, François Pinault senior, 72, is proud of his son's achievements. He tells Fortune, "He has a lot of sang-froid. I'm impressed - but don't tell him that. We're not a family that gives compliments easily."

Although the younger Pinault is described as "humble" and lacks the typical arrogance of a billionaire heir, he still dabbles in the pursuits of the very rich when he isn't running the company. He had an Aston Martin sports car, which he later traded in for a Lexus hybrid and he has a collection of more than 60 pricey watches, at least one of which he's tried to dismantle out of curiosity. When he's not visiting his glamorous wife Salma and their 2-year-old daughter, Valentina, in Los Angeles or New York, he's playing tennis or working out with a boxing trainer.

So far, the new 47-year old heir is doing well. Despite a slump in the market, Pinault's decsions, including buying a 70% controlling stake in Puma has helped to buffer PPR against the downturn. Cost controls, cutbacks and various business-savvy moves have also helped PPR keep an even keel.

Ultimately, luxury products are still saleable. "People are still buying it, and price perception has not changed," he says.
